## TransGrid Farm — Contractor Onboarding

Welcome to the Vennport transcoding team. TransGrid workers pull jobs from the encode queue, write progress to the jobs database, and upload renditions to cold storage. Before running a worker locally, request read-write access from your team lead and confirm your VPN profile is active. Once approved, configure your worker with the jobs database connection string below.

replica DSN, yahaf-yagaf: mongodb://tamath_svc:a2netSk3RZMuTj@db-d084.novacsoft.internal:5432/ralmir

## v4.2.0 — Setting renamed

The old `PIN_STRICT_MODE` flag in Lockstep has been renamed to `DEPENDENCY_PIN_POLICY` to match the new three-tier pinning scheme (exact, minor, floating). Future maintainers: the legacy name is still read until v5.0, but emits a deprecation warning at startup. Update your `.env` files now to avoid surprises. The registry mirror also requires authentication under the new policy, so add the following line to your environment file:

sealed setting: VAULT_KEY20=c8ea1e419912889df6b4

## Idempotency Keys for Payment Retries

When reviewing changes to the Pondbridge payment worker, confirm every retry path reuses the original idempotency key rather than minting a new one. Keys are derived from the order ID plus attempt epoch, hashed server-side, and stored in the ledger table for 72 hours. A duplicate key with a different payload must be rejected, not merged. The hashing step reads its HMAC secret from the environment, set on the following line.

vault entry, yahif-yajep: COURIER_KEY29=b802bdf8034096b65a51c6ba5abe2